            @Bungle68 it’s the module MMM-Simpke-Logo.
            what does it expect for the file: parameter?

            it’s actually fileUrl:

            Screenshot_20221202-062046_Chrome.jpg

            note that the image file must be IN the MagicMirror folder tree
